### Changelog — Chipgate Reader v4.2: Default changes

For new team members: v4.2 of the Chipgate timing reader changes several defaults that affect split capture at mat crossings. The read window widens to reduce missed tags in dense packs, and duplicate suppression now keys on tag plus mat rather than tag alone. Deployments upgrading from v4.1 inherit the new defaults automatically, listed here:

deployment values, kajep-kageg:
[praix]
host = praix.paliqcorp.corp
user = praix_svc
database = praix_prod

Finance Review Summary — Q2 Cash-Flow Forecast

Prepared for heads of department at Norvane Industries. Operating inflows track slightly ahead of plan, offset by earlier-than-expected capital spend on the Tillbrook expansion. Receivables aging remains stable. Departmental forecasts are due by month-end. The confidential planning note supporting these assumptions appears below.

confidential, bahip-hadug: Headcount on the Norir team goes from 29 to 116 by the end of August. Gross margin on Norir came in at 6 percent against a plan of 59 percent.

Subject: DR drill for Gridwright plugin sandbox

Hello plugin authors,

Next Thursday we will run a disaster-recovery drill for the Gridwright crossword generator. Plugin endpoints will fail over to the cold replica for roughly two hours; expect brief clue-generation timeouts. To re-register your plugin against the replica, authenticate with the drill passphrase provided below.

vault phrase of taweg-kafof = oliax-zorael